68 config ZYNQMP_SPL_PM_CFG_OBJ_FILE
69 string "PMU firmware configuration object to load at runtime by SPL"
72 Path to a binary PMU firmware configuration object to be linked
73 into U-Boot SPL and loaded at runtime into the PMU firmware.
75 The ZynqMP Power Management Unit (PMU) needs a configuration
76 object for most SoC peripherals to work. To have it loaded by
77 U-Boot SPL set here the file name (absolute path or relative to
78 the top source tree) of your configuration, which must be a
79 binary blob. It will be linked in the SPL binary and loaded
80 into the PMU firmware by U-Boot SPL during board
83 Leave this option empty if your PMU firmware has a hard-coded
84 configuration object or you are loading it by any other means.
